A leading Asset Management firm is currently looking to recruit an Associate Director to manage their UK and European Investment Compliance monitoring team.

The purpose of the role is leading the new UK/ European Investment Compliance monitoring team. This new team will be responsible for Retail and Institutional products investment compliance monitoring as part of the European Investment Compliance function. The Associate Director will oversee the management of the team in the UK on a daily basis. Please note that this role will be based in Kent.

 

Key accountabilities

 

Initial Period

  • Assist the Global Investment Compliance project team with the successful transition of the monitoring function of UK/European products from overseas to the UK.

Ongoing

  • Integrate new team with existing investment compliance teams.
  • Work with senior management to develop a compliance team structure that best supports the UK and European base Investment Management function,
  • Provide leadership to ensure that the team performs against specified goals and objectives.
  • Oversee team in the performance of their functions:
  • Analyze and comment on investment guidelines for European institutional client accounts and retail funds.
  • Develop and maintain procedures with an emphasis on risk points and related controls.
  • Identify, track, resolve and report compliance breaches in line with internal policy and regulatory requirements
  • Assist in delivering global Fund Manager education for investment compliance.

 

Required skills and experience

 

  • Degree-level educated. CFA / ACA / ACCA preferred.
  • Solid experience in an investment compliance role, with proven ability operating at a senior level.
  • In depth knowledge of FSA/CSSF regulations as they relate to the Investment powers and limits of UCITs and UCI’s
  • Excellent understanding of financial instruments including equities, fixed income and derivatives
